Output 1570fde68c554a8f09df4ed8912dd2e6dd42131f61bf001e69e7c6ac0c3ebb3e:35

value
1009634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8627698100ac1051f07055f29a05230c7b590079 OP_EQUAL
address
3DvMgejmHJfH29XYB9BDwe9ke8xbpB8mz9
transaction
1570fde68c554a8f09df4ed8912dd2e6dd42131f61bf001e69e7c6ac0c3ebb3e
spent
true